In a natural circulation hot water heating system, what component collects excess water?

In a natural circulation hot water heating system, the expansion tank plays a crucial role in maintaining system pressure and collecting excess water. As the water in the heating system is heated, it expands; this increase in volume creates pressure that needs to be managed to prevent damage to the system. The expansion tank provides a space for this excess water to expand into, thereby absorbing the increased volume and preventing pressure build-up.

The expansion tank is designed to accommodate the fluctuations in water volume caused by temperature changes. This flexibility ensures the overall safety and efficiency of the heating system, as it helps maintain optimal operating conditions. Without an expansion tank, excess pressure can lead to leaks or even catastrophic failure in the piping system. Thus, the correct identification of the expansion tank as the component that collects excess water is vital for understanding how natural circulation hot water heating systems function.
